This Dad Left His GoPro On Selfie Mode While On Vacation And The Results Are Hilarious

by N/A, 10 years ago | 2 min read

Evan Griffin's father recently went on vacation from Ireland to Las Vegas. Sounds like a great getaway, yet these days, unfortunately, it's pics or it didn't happen. So, Griffin equipped his father with a video camera. Here's what happened: 

"So... Gave my Dad my GoPro while he was in Las Vegas, I did not, however, instruct him on how to use it, so my dad being my dad, and a culchie, didn't know which way to point the fucking thing..."

BTW: 'Culchie' is essentially Irish for 'hillbilly.'
